Old Masters auctions total more than $120 million (Reuters)
Reuters - Old Masters paintings brought in more than $120 million at auction sales this week, with several works selling for more than $5 million each and records set for some artists. View full post on Yahoo! News: Arts
Study: Americans spend more on arts than movies (AP)
AP - The National Endowment for the Arts has released a new study showing that although more Americans regularly go to the movies, they spend more money on the performing arts in terms of ticket revenue. View full post on Yahoo! News: Arts
More than bums on seats: Australian Participation in the arts
Do you think arts are elitist or only for baby boomers? Think again. According to a new survey, 9 in 10 Australians participate in the arts, and 4 in 10 Australians create art themselves. More than bums on seats: Australian participation in the arts is a new research from the Australia Council for the Arts. This video is about what art participation means in real terms, and paints a picture of Australians and the art in 21st century.
